Xorg/Nouveau crashes with Segmentation fault when setting i7-Skylake iGPU as
primary grapics device in BIOS

Hardware:
CPU: i7-6700k (Intel HD Graphics 530)
MB: Asus H110M2 D3
GPU: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 750ti

How to reproduce:
- Install fresh Ubuntu Gnome 15.10 (Side note, graphic issues with standard
drivers, goes away with NVIDIA drivers so no big problem there)
- Install Kernel 4.3.4
- Install Intel drivers / compile and install latest Intel drivers
- Reboot
- iGPU isn't recognized as VGA compatible card
- Reboot and set primary graphics device to 'CPU Graphics' in BIOS
--> iGPU now is recognized
--> Xorg lives for approx. 1-2 seconds and then crashes

Xorg Version: X.Org X Server 1.17.2

Matthias, thank you for reporting this and helping make Ubuntu better. However,
your crash report is manually attached.

Please follow these instructions to have apport report a new bug about your
crash that can be dealt with by the automatic retracer. First, execute at a
terminal:
cd /var/crash && sudo rm * ; sudo apt-get update && sudo apt-get -y
dist-upgrade && sudo service apport start force_start=1

If you are running the Ubuntu Stable Release you might need to enable apport in
/etc/default/apport and restart. Now reproduce the crash, then open a terminal,
navigate to your /var/crash directory and file your report with:
sudo ubuntu-bug /var/crash/_my_crash_report.crash

where _my_crash_report.crash is the crash you would like to report. By default,
this sends the crash to the Ubuntu Error Tracker infrastructure, which is
different than Launchpad. For more on this, please see
https://wiki.ubuntu.com/ErrorTracker .  

However, if after doing this you would still like to have a crash report posted
to Launchpad, for example to ease triage and add others to your report, one
would need to open the following file via a terminal:
sudo nano /etc/apport/crashdb.conf

and comment out the line:
'problem_types': ['Bug', 'Package'],

by changing it to:
# 'problem_types': ['Bug', 'Package'],

Save, close, and file the crash report via:
sudo ubuntu-bug /var/crash/FILENAME.crash

Where FILENAME is the actual name of the file found in the folder.

However, this report is being closed since the process outlined above will deal
with this issue more efficiently.

Also, please do not attach your crash report manually to this report and reopen
it.

Thank you for your understanding.
